[NPL] Rules
 
SourceForts – No Pro's League


Rules based on Stieffers' posted February 19th, 2007 – Revision #12
Player Code Of Conduct

Player Conduct
All players will be required to refrain from harassment, insult, and general unsportsmanlike conduct during matches. Offenders may gain their team a forfeit loss, and suspension for repeated offenses.

Player Information
All players must have their SteamIDs on their player profile for the league. SteamIDs will be allowed to be changed only once, to prevent “ringers”. Any player found playing under another player’s SteamID will gain both players a suspension, as well as a forfeit loss for their team.

Customization
No custom models, sounds, skins, or textures may be used by any player participating in the league. Any use of customized models, sounds, skins or textures changing the visibility of the player(read Mat Hacks here...) will result in a suspension for the offending player, and a forfeit loss for his or her team.

Messaging
Only team captains will be permitted to use the global chat (message mode 1) once the match goes live. Team captains should not use this ability to harass or insult the other team. Extreme offenses may result in suspensions.

Multi-clanning
Multi-clanning of any type is not permitted. A player may be on one team roster/Line-up at any given time. Any player found to be on multiple rosters or found to be using multiple SteamID’s to dodge league standards is subject to long term or permanent suspension dependent on administrative judgment.

Hacking / Cheating
The use of third party software to modify the game is prohibited. Players found cheating or hacking will be suspsended indefinately.

Pre-match Preparations


Pre-match
Pre-Match is to take place in the specified pre-match map (sf_League_PreMatch). This map will contain models of both team's blocks as well as all of the player models. Do not kill or injure opposing players during pre-match fight round.

Screenshots
All players on both teams are required to take screenshots (with F5 by default), during the pre-match map round, to verify compliance with league rules. These screenshots must include:
  1. A Rebel (red) and Combine (blue) player model.
  2. The player's scoreboard (opened with the Tab key)
  3. A red and blue bloc.
#1 and #3 can be on the same Screenshot.

Team leaders must take a screenshot of the status in console (viewed by typing “status” in their console) to verify player SteamIDs. No combat or killing of enemies or teammates should take place during the screenshot period. Failure to have these screenshots in the event of a dispute will automatically earn you a forfeit loss, and suspension for repeat offenders.

If a player disconnects and then rejoins, they must retake all screenshots in order to prevent instances of model or material swapping.


Starting a match

Teams have a 15 minute grace period to join the match server after the decided match time. If after 15 minutes, Team A has all 5 of their players in the server, while Team B does not, then Team A can take screenshots and report a forfeit win.

Once all 5 players from both teams are in the server, screenshots have been taken and demos started, and both team captains have verified that they are ready to start, the match can be started.


No-Pros-League Specific Rules

Who's Non-Pro?
No "pros" will be accepted in the league, by "Pros" i mean people that knows how to play, and have been playing for more than 5 months. League-Admins will judge if the player can join the league or not during Clan registration. If a player considered as "pro" is found smurfing as a new player will result in the disqualification of the whole team.


Rules

Map selection
For each matches, 2 maps will be played: one for each team. Home-team will go RED.
A Map List will be established. If you wish to add a map in the map list, contact a league admin. No match may be played on any map not approved for league play.

Building
Prebuilds will be set up on servers, If a team do want to build then both teams have to agree to build. Only 10 minutes will be given to build during the first Build Round. If both team are ready before the counter is down to 0, the phase may be toggled by an admin. Remember that we don't have prebuilds for every map in the Map-list.

Rule Changes
All rules are subject to change by league administration at any time. Rule changes will be announced and it is a player’s responsibility to not be caught in violation. Ignorance is not a valid argument against the breaking of rules.

Exploits
Because of the inability for admins to monitor every single league match, and because of the nature of exploits, all exploits will be allowed besides the following exploits:


List of "illegal" exploits
  • Player cannons: The abuse of havoc physics errors to impart propulsion energy on the player greater then could be achieved through the player's normal movement abilities, through interaction with blocks.
  • Build time exploits: You are not allowed access to the opposing team's build area during build time.
  • Physlocks: putting a certain amount of blocs in the same area will create a physlock, those blocs can't be moved until some breaks during combat phase.

Configuration
Servers will be chosen by League Admins, A League.cfg will be made and needs to be executed on those servers during League matches. If you'd like to Host some League matches, contact a League Admin.

Disputes

Filing Disputes
If an opposing team is in violation of league rules a team may submit a dispute to league administration. Disputes must be submitted within 48 hours of the match in question and must be submitted with any relevent evidence a team may wish to include. Disputes will be dealt with on a case by case basis depending on the nature and severity of the offense. Filing frivilous disputes may result in team or individual suspension in repeat cases.

Investigating Disputes
League admins may ask any player on any team involved in the dispute for any demo or screenshot evidence they should have as per league rules. Failure to comply can lead to player suspensions and a team forfeit.
